A graveside funeral service, celebrating the life of Robert Clarence Diener, age 86 of Centerville, Ohio, formerly of Newark, will be held on Thursday, March 8, 2018 at 11:00 a.m. at Welsh Hills Cemetery, with Pastor Allen Stump officiating. Robert was born in Prospect, PA on June 22, 1931 to the late Clarence A. Diener and Ella Goldina (Grossman) Doughty. He passed away at his residence on March 4, 2018. Prior to retirement in 2007, he was a plumber and was a plumbing inspector for the city of Newark for 31 years. He also served as chief inspector for the State of Ohio for five years. Robert was a founding member of the Mary Ann Township Volunteer Fire Department and was a lifetime member of the Ohio Association of Plumbing Inspectors.
